Effective Guides to Finding a Good Painting Firm
Picking a paint firm can be complicated. You desire a person with expertise for your sort of project and who makes the effort to make certain whatever is done right.



Cost is also vital yet you do not want a company that bids reduced and afterwards skimps on products, avoids security protocols, or brings un-vetted subcontractors right into your home.

1. Ask Around
The very best place to begin your search for a reliable paint firm is with family and friends. Ask your colleagues that they've used for their paint jobs and what they liked concerning that service provider.

Make sure to listen diligently and ask the best questions throughout these conversations. These key inquiries will certainly help you determine which painting companies to talk to for estimates.

Have a look at paint service providers' social networks accounts, Facebook web pages and internet site to see their work. Seek genuine project images (not supply photos) and house owner testimonies. Likewise, see to it you learn whether a paint business is licensed in your area. Licensing needs vary from one state to another. A legitimate paint firm ought to have no worry offering you with evidence of their license and insurance policy protection.

2. Obtain Quotes
Getting multiple quotes is a vital part of the paint procedure. It offers you the chance to get a more accurate picture of how much your paint work will cost and what each business needs to supply. It also enables you to contrast them and see which one has the best value.

A great painting professional must supply an in-depth quote that consists of all components of the project, including labor costs and the brand and sort of paint being made use of. This ensures transparency and protects against any surprises when it comes time to foot the bill.

This additionally gives an outstanding method to learn if the paint contractor is truthful and trustworthy. If they hesitate to give you a written estimate, it is likely that they will be less than credible and expert.

5. Ask Questions
As you limit your list of paint contractors, ask inquiries concerning their previous tasks. Discover if the pros made sure to safeguard and cover exterior landscaping, autos, and furniture (for outside tasks) or tidied up and put back personal items (for interior job).

Inquire about their prep process and just how they avoid blunders. Also, ask whether their painters are staff members or subcontractors, and whether they have liability insurance policy in case somebody gets hurt on duty.

It's not uncommon for painting professionals to obtain negative evaluations, yet take a look at just how the firm responds to them. If they are apologetic and attend to the issue directly, that is a great sign. Finally, see to it the painter is licensed in your state.
